# Standardised function to run Bayesian updating using BUGS and return dataframe
running.bugs<-function(model, data, variable.names, n.burnin, n.iter, thin, inits = NULL){
##'@param model - file path for model
##'@param data - a list of the data to inform model
##'@param variable names - a vector of variable names to be tracked
##'@param n.burnin - the number of iterations to be used as burnin for the Markov chains
##'@param n.iter - the number of iterations for the Markov chains
##'@param thin - the thinning interval for the monitors
##'@param inits - initial values for the MCMC algoritm
# Monitor results from bugs updating
samples <- R2OpenBUGS::bugs(data,
inits = inits,
parameters.to.save=variable.names,
model.file=model,
n.burnin = n.burnin,
n.iter = n.iter+n.burnin,
n.thin = thin,
n.chain = 1,
DIC = FALSE,
debug = FALSE)
# Create dataframe for results
samples.df <- as.data.frame(samples$sims.array[,1,])
return(samples.df)
}
